The Dawn of Agentic AI Era

AI technology landscape showing futuristic digital elements and neural networks

The year 2025 marks a pivotal moment in the evolution of artificial intelligence and technology. We're witnessing what experts call the "Year of Agentic AI" – a transformative shift where AI systems move beyond simple question-answering to autonomous task execution and decision-making.[1][2]

Agentic AI represents a fundamental paradigm shift from reactive to proactive artificial intelligence. These systems can plan, reason, use tools, and perform complex tasks with minimal human intervention. Unlike traditional chatbots that simply respond to queries, agentic AI can scope out entire projects, break them down into manageable tasks, and execute them independently using whatever tools are necessary.[3]

Global Tech Landscape: Leaders and Innovators

Global technology map showcasing India as a major tech innovation hub

The global technology ecosystem has become increasingly interconnected, with several key players driving innovation at an unprecedented pace. Meta is investing a staggering $66-72 billion in AI infrastructure for 2025, representing a doubling of their previous year's investment. This massive commitment includes building "titan clusters" like Prometheus in Ohio, which will be among the first AI superclusters to hit 1 gigawatt of compute power.[4]

OpenAI continues to push boundaries with the anticipated release of GPT-5 in August 2025. The new model promises to eliminate the complexity of model switching by combining all previous models into one unified system that "knows when to think for a long time or not". This represents a significant leap toward more intuitive AI interactions.[5]

Google's Gemini 2.5 has established itself as the most intelligent AI model, topping the LMArena leaderboard by a significant margin. The model showcases enhanced reasoning capabilities and improved accuracy through "thinking models" that analyze their responses before providing answers.[6]

India's Rise as a Tech Powerhouse

Indian developers and entrepreneurs working on AI startup projects

India's technology sector is experiencing remarkable growth, with the IT industry contributing 7.5% of the country's GDP in FY23 and expected to reach 10% by FY25. The country's AI startup ecosystem has raised over $1.5 billion between 2022 and Q1 2025, though 80% of this funding has focused on application-layer solutions rather than foundational infrastructure.[7][8]

Key developments in India's tech landscape include:

·        Digital Infrastructure Expansion: With 76 crore Indian citizens having internet access, the country is poised for its next growth phase[8]

·        Government Support: Initiatives like 67 Software Technology Parks of India (STPIs), 100% Foreign Direct Investment (FDI), and the National Policy on Software Products (NPSP) are driving industry growth[8]

·        Export Growth: IT export revenue is predicted to reach $224 billion in FY25, with potential to surpass $300 billion in FY26[8]

2. Advanced Connectivity (5G/6G Networks) - 75% Adoption

While 5G continues expanding globally, India is already testing 6G networks and satellite-based internet to connect remote areas. These technologies enable high-speed communication essential for IoT, autonomous vehicles, and augmented reality applications.[10][11]

3. IoT and Edge Computing - 80% Adoption

The Internet of Things is projected to reach 30 billion connected devices by 2025, up from 16.6 billion in 2023. Smart cities are leveraging IoT for traffic management, energy optimization, and public safety.[11]

5. Cybersecurity AI - 65% Adoption

AI-powered cybersecurity systems protecting against digital threats

AI is revolutionizing cybersecurity with 24.4% projected growth rate from 2025 to 2030, reaching $93.75 billion by 2030. Key applications include:[16]

·        Real-time Threat Detection: AI systems analyzing vast datasets to identify and predict threats[16]

·        Zero Trust Architecture: 86.5% of organizations are embracing zero-trust security models[16]

·        Shadow AI Detection: Organizations are recognizing the scope of unsanctioned AI models used by staff[17]
